>> Summary
>>
>> Ad slot size in real-time bidding signals fetch:
>>
>> Protected Audience ad selection auctions allow buyers to fetch real-time
>> signals from their key-value server.  Besides being used for calculating
>> bid prices, these signals can also be used for prioritizing and filtering
>> potential ad candidates.  The more ad candidate filtration and
>> prioritization that we can enable, the more performant the auction is (e.g.
>> less browser resource utilization) and the higher the quality of the chosen
>> ad candidates is.  This feature extends the signals about the page where
>> the ad will be displayed from just its domain name, to also include the
>> size of the ad slots on the page, which is a very useful signal for
>> filtering out ads that cannot be rendered in that slot size.
>>
>> Allow updating interest group’s userBiddingSignals and executionMode:
>>
>> Protected Audience has always supported updating interest group fields,
>> but for historical reasons did not support updating the interest group
>> field named userBiddingSignals, and for no obvious reason did not support
>> updating executionMode. This change is a small extension to Protected
>> Audience interest group updating to support updating these fields, making
>> the API more useful by being able to update/refresh the fields with more up
>> to date information.

>> Debuggability
>>
>> Ad slot size in real-time bidding signals fetch: The extra
>> runAdAuction() and joinAdInterestGroup() parameters should be visible in
>> DevTools, as should the real-time bidding signal fetches in the DevTools
>> network panel.
>>
>> Update more interest group fields: The updates should be visible in
>> DevTools’ Application Storage Interest Group section.
